Spielberg linked to Biblical epic

Steven Spielberg could be set to make the story of Moses for the big screen

Thursday January 26 2012

Steven Spielberg is being tipped to make a big-screen retelling of the Moses story, according to reports.

Deadline said that the Schindler's List director is close to signing the deal to direct the film, given the working title Gods And Kings.

The film is described as a "'Braveheartish version of the Moses story" mixed with the "gritty reality" of Saving Private Ryan.

"There have been glossy versions of the Moses story but this would be a real warrior story," an insider told the website.

Warner Bros first approached the filmmaker, who has just finished Lincoln and is set to make the sci-fi story Robopocalypse, last September.

Gods And Kings would begin production next year.

Meanwhile, Darren Aronofsky is working on a Noah's Ark film, while Mel Gibson is planning his own epic tale about Judah Maccabee.
